Shift Manager Jobs in Washington: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for shift managers in Washington?

Large retail, hospitality, and food service employers account for most shift manager sponsorship activity in Washington. Companies like Starbucks (headquartered in Seattle), Amazon (which operates large fulfillment and retail footprints), and major hotel brands with properties in the Seattle metro have filed for sponsored shift management roles. Sponsorship is more common at large multi-location operators than at independent or small businesses.

Which visa types are most common for shift manager roles in Washington?

H-1B visa is the most recognized work visa but requires the role to qualify as a specialty occupation, which is difficult for most shift manager positions unless there is a strong operational or technical specialization. L-1 visas are an option for internal transfers within multinational companies. Some candidates from Australia may explore the E-3 visa. TN visas cover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ying occupations. Each pathway depends on the specific role structure and employer.

Which cities in Washington have the most shift manager sponsorship jobs?

Seattle and the broader King County area, including Bellevue and Redmond, generate the highest concentration of shift manager sponsorship jobs in Washington. Tacoma and Spokane also see activity, particularly in logistics, food service, and hospitality. Seattle's density of corporate headquarters, tourism infrastructure, and major fulfillment operations creates demand for operations-level management roles across multiple industries.

Are there state-specific considerations for shift manager visa sponsorship in Washington?

Washington's strong union presence in certain industries and its strict labor regulations can affect how employers structure shift manager roles, which in turn affects sponsorship eligibility assessments. The state's prevailing wage requirements for sponsored workers are set at the federal level under DOL guidelines, but Washington's higher local wage standards can influence what employers offer. Seattle's competitive labor market also means sponsored candidates are often expected to bring specialized operational experience.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ored shift manager jobs in Washington?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
